Service Accounts — Deep-Link Routing (Mosswright Mobile)

As a new contractor, you'll interact with the deep-link router that maps inbound mobile links to in-app destinations. Each environment has its own service account; never reuse staging credentials in production. Route tables are versioned, and changes require a routing review before merge. To query the router's resolution endpoint during local testing, your client must present the key that appears below.

gateway credential: zpat4_626B

### Step 4 — Apply rate limits

Before enabling the Grayline gateway on internal routes, apply the per-client rate limiting policy. Limits are enforced at the edge worker, keyed on the service token, with a sliding window and burst allowance. Overrides require sign-off from the platform lead. Set the following configuration values on the gateway.

service settings:
quenath:
  log_level: info
  metrics_host: metrics.quenath.tolvaqlabs.internal
  pin: 1407
  pool_size: 8

**Wiki: Break-Glass Access — Fernmap Offline Mode**

If a field crew is stuck offline and their Fernmap sync token expires mid-survey, on-call can grant break-glass access without the auth service. Don't do this casually — it bypasses audit hooks until the next sync. Open the admin panel, pick "offline override," and when prompted, enter the recovery passphrase printed directly below.

recovery phrase for bawif-hahif: ralael-tamdor

Runbook — Flaky DNS on the Ostermill cluster

Every few weeks, lookups for internal services start timing out intermittently, usually after a node pool upgrade. Root cause (so far): the node-local cache keeps stale upstream addresses and only notices after its TTL cycles. Quick fix: bounce the cache daemonset, not the core resolver — restarting the core makes everything worse for ~5 minutes. If bouncing doesn't help within two cycles, fail over to the secondary resolvers. First, verify the resolver config matches the values recorded below.

deployment values, tafof-taduf:
pelius:
  pin: 6508
  tenant: praiel
  seal: seal_4e33a2f4
  metrics_host: metrics.pelius.plorvagrid.corp
  standby_team: druix
  escalation: juldor-norius
  nonce: 5db598